Allow us to create our own content!

How?

SANDBOX Features!

Examples:

Storyteller NPCs = Allow us to buy items we can place in the open world, like static vehicles, NPCs to fight, Buildings, special effects... speeder "check points" so we can build temporary race tracts... dueling arena's or pits with dangerous environmental items inside so we can host our own gladiatorial combat... the possibilities here, are endless.

Player Housing, Player Cities, and Player Capital Ships = the possibilities with this are endless. Allow us to build our own houses / cities within instanced version of the planets. Example... I go to Coruscant, I travel to a "instance taxi" and from there I jump into my house, city, etc. Instanced housing could be great for placing all sorts of things, decorations, hosting guild events, and so on.

Player Vendors: Allow players to place, in their own house, city, space station, a Player Vendor, where they this could act like a Guild Bank/GTN terminal all in one.

Interactive Environments: I know I would love to get a bunch of Jedi, go into our own instance of the Jedi Council Chambers on Tython, and RP a Council Meeting... especially if we can SIT IN CHAIRS!

Allowing the players to create content, generate their own place in the galaxy that feels like it is "theirs" will go a long way to keeping many players here, playing, and coming back for more.

Plus... you can put most of this stuff on the Cartel Market and make a fortune from it.

I agree. However, there are certain limitation it WOULD have to abide to.

1) Designated sandbox areas, ideally instances "owned" by players and maybe guilds (AND, not OR), so they can control access and permissions to "their" area as they please, but also so players CAN'T adjust existing game environments.

2) No uploading of textures, models, etcetera. Only usage of existing game assets (though Bioware could create some for this very purpose, or have some built-in designer, and charge CC for them, one way or another)

3) Anything created within the sandbox areas stays within the sandbox areas. No, we don't want your custom chair on the GTN, even less see it plopped down on the fleet or in the middle of the Tatooine desert! Not even custom designed gear or weapons. They all have to stay within the sandbox.

4) No experience gain within sandboxed areas.

5) No WZ points gained within sandboxed areas.

6) No loot for killing mobs within sandboxed areas.

Simply put, you can't leave a sandboxed area with more <whatever> on your character than how you entered, only less..
You can only bring something from Sandbox 1 to Sandbox 2 with the permission of the owners of both sandboxes. (to prevent introducing griefing tools from one sandbox to another).
